2010-11-02 16 views
0

J'ai un tout nouveau site web e-commerce (http://missfrisette.com/showphotos.php) chaque élément (pince à cheveux) peut être acheterSimpleCart (JS) prix multiples

  • 1 pince = 2
  • $
  • 2 pince = 3 $
  • 1 bigclip = 3
  • $
  • 2 bigclip = 5
  • $

donc je voudrais avoir 4 autre bouton qui envoie 4 définition différente dans le panier ...

comment faire tha avec SimpleCart ou dans un autre panier (php et javascript s'il vous plaît) merci

Répondre

0

voici ma solution. la seule limite, est tout le prix devrait être différent

<select class="item_price"> 
<option value="2.00">1 clip</option>' 
<option value="3.00">2 clips</option>' 
<option value="3.50">1 pince</option> 
<option value="5.00">2 pinces</option> 
</select> 
1

La réponse par @menardmam vraiment aidé moi- mais je encore besoin du nom de l'élément spécifique à être transféré à la caisse PayPal. Donc, c'est un peu hacky, mais j'ai utilisé un peu de jquery et l'ai fait pour faire ce dont j'avais besoin. Ce problème ne semble pas être adressé nulle part même après avoir cherché pendant 2 bonnes heures.

Si vous avez plusieurs produits, vous devrez créer une autre classe au lieu de .item_name. J'avais seulement besoin d'une tarification multiple pour un produit. Les produits à plusieurs prix multiples exigeront un code légèrement plus sophistiqué.

http://api.jquery.com/change/

<script> 
$("select").change(function() { 
     var str = ""; 
     $("select option:selected").each(function() { 
      str += $(this).text() + " "; 
      }); 
     $(".item_name").text(str); 
    }) 
    .change(); 
</script>